New Xbox models are up for preorder. You can now place orders for two new variants of Xbox Series X, as well as a new 1TB Xbox Series S. Specifically, there's a flashy new 2TB Galaxy Black Xbox Series X for $599.99, as well as a new 1TB All-Digital Robot White Xbox Series X for $449.99. The 1TB Robot White Xbox Series S is also available for preorder and goes for $349.99. All the new configurations are available at the Microsoft Store and other retailers. Let’s take a look.

This model comes packed with a full 2TB of super-fast onboard storage. The console itself also has a spattering of green and white stars speckled all around it, as does the circular D-pad on the controller. It looks quite fetching, if you ask me.

For those who are ready to ditch physical games for good, the All-Digital Robot White Xbox Series X has you covered. It costs $150 less than the Galaxy Black model above, and it comes with 1TB of storage for your digital games.

Those who prefer the slimmer form factor of the Xbox Series S (and who also don't care for a disc drive) can preorder the 1TB Xbox Series S. The only thing new here, really, is the built-in 1TB SSD, which offers more storage space for games than the previous model, which features 500GB of storage.
